Jesus honored, obeyed and taught powerfully the 10 Commandments. This is what the great Sermon on the Mount is all about. Jesus did not come to set aside the Law, but to fulfill it: to keep it, to explain it, to fulfill it to the “T”. Throughout the Sermon (Matthew 5-7), Jesus exposes the corrupt, hypocritical teaching and practice of the Pharisees and Jewish religious leaders of His day. If He was here today, I fear He would say the very same things to our pastors and religious leaders.
“You have heard it said (by the Pharisees) … but I say to you …” Jesus clearly applies the 10 commandments in a positive way. Moses gives the Law in negatives — You shall NOT … Jesus teaches us You shall .. not the shallowest application, but the deepest. This is a subject for a whole book.*
“Hear, O Israel, The LORD our God is One! You shall love the LORD your God with all your heart, with all your soul, and with all your might. And these words (Moses just renewed the 10 commandments) which I command you today shall be in your heart; you shall teach them diligently to your children, and talk of them when you sit down in your house, when you walk by the way, when you lie down and when your rise up. You shall bind them as a sign on your hand and they shall be as frontlets between your eyes (like eye-glasses that bring everything in life into focus). You shall write them on the doorposts of your house and on your gates.” (Deuteronomy 6:4-9)
“Only take heed to yourselves, and diligently keep yourself, lest you forget the things which your eyes have seen and lest they depart from your heart all the days of your life. And teach them to your children and grandchildren ..” (Deuteronomy 4:9)
Consider the Word of God to Joshua —
“Only be strong and very courageous that you may observe to do according to all the Law of which Moses My servant commanded you; do not turn from it to the right hand or the left, that you may prosper wherever you go. The Book of the Law shall not depart from your mouth, but you shall meditate in it day and night, that you may observe to do according to all that is written in it. For then you will make your way prosperous, and they you will have good success.” (Joshua 1:6-9)
“Blessed is the man .. who delights in the Law of the LORD, and in His Law he meditates day and night. He shall be like a tree planted by the rivers of water, that brings for its fruit in its season, whose leaf shall not wither; and whatever he does shall prosper.” (Psalm 1:3)
The Bible is filled with these passages that say the same basic thing over and over and over again. Clear, simple, direct. Keep God’s Law in your mind, your heart, your home, your recreation — and teach them diligently to your children and grandchildren! Be careful to obey the Law!
